Goldschläger is a Swiss cinnamon schnapps (43.5% alcohol by volume or 87 proof; originally it was 53.5% alcohol or 107 proof), [1] a liqueur with very thin, yet visible flakes of 24-karat gold floating in it. [2] The actual amount of gold has been measured at approximately 13 milligrams (0.20 grains) in a one-litre bottle. [3]

Gold Strike is a Dutch cinnamon liqueur containing gold snippets, produced by Lucas Bols. The company suggests it should be drunk as a shot, with the motto "Shake, Shoot and Strike". [ 1 ] It is a clear liquid that tastes like cinnamon candy.

Some brands, like Goldschlager and cinnamon Schnapps contain snippets of gold leaf. Other alcoholic beverages that contain cinnamon include infused vodkas, such as Smirnoff's Cinna-Sugar Twist. [1] In November 2013, Beam's Pinnacle Vodka and Cinnabon teamed up to introduce their own brand of cinnamon flavored vodka, Cinnabon Vodka.
